Bill Gates Recommends AI Education Book by Khan Academy CEO

Separator
Bill Gates, the Co-Founder of Microsoft, has recommended a book authored by Sal Khan, the Founder and CEO of the educational nonprofit Khan Academy. Titled "Brave New Words: How AI Will Revolutionize Education (And Why That’s a Good Thing)", Gates expressed that this book is a must-read for everyone.

In a post on X (formerly Twitter), Gates emphasized the significance of Khan's work in the realm of education, particularly focusing on the potential of artificial intelligence (AI) to enhance learning worldwide. Gates lauded Khan's compelling vision for utilizing AI to expand opportunities for all learners.

'Brave New Words' delves into the transformative impact of AI-powered systems, such as ChatGPT, on education. These systems have the capacity to revolutionize the learning and teaching process by assisting educators and customizing lessons to meet individual needs. Gates highlighted the book's exploration of how AI tutoring can help bridge educational disparities, particularly among low-income students in developing countries.

During a podcast featuring Sal Khan, Gates discussed the role of AI in education, likening it to having a great high school teacher who provides personalized feedback to students. He emphasized that AI tools can elevate the overall level of achievement while narrowing the education gap between different demographic groups.

Gates expressed optimism about the future of education, envisioning how AI-driven innovations can contribute to significant improvements in learning outcomes. He emphasized the importance of leveraging these new tools to ensure that every student has access to high-quality education, regardless of their background.
